  1. 21. Combustion Simulations with reduced mechanisms using hybrid optimization

    University essay from Lunds universitet/Fysiska institutionen; Lunds universitet/Förbränningsfysik

    Author : Marius Burman Ingeberg; [2018]
    Keywords : Optimization; Reduced mechanism; Hybrid optimization; simulated annealing; Genetic algorithm; Physics and Astronomy;

    Abstract : In order to simulate complex combustion systems, the kinetic mechanisms describing the chemical processes have to be reduced. To minimize the error introduced by the reduction, coefficients of the reaction rates included in the mechanisms can be adjusted in ways so that simulations using the reduced mechanism behave like simulations that use detailed mechanisms.   3. 23. Artificial Neural Networks in Swedish Speech Synthesis

    University essay from KTH/Tal-kommunikation

    Author : Per Näslund; [2018]
    Keywords : Speech Synthesis; neural; LSTM; Speech Technology; Tacotron; Attention; CNN; Neural Networks; RNN;

    Abstract : Text-to-speech (TTS) systems have entered our daily lives in the form of smart assistants and many other applications. Contemporary re- search applies machine learning and artificial neural networks (ANNs) to synthesize speech. It has been shown that these systems outperform the older concatenative and parametric methods. READ MORE
